โœฆ Synopsis


Direct separation of the enantiomers of the two diastereomers, menthone and isomenthone, was performed using an octakis-(IO-butyryl-2,6-di-O-pentyl)-y-cyclodextrin phase. Enantiomerically pure (-)-menthone and (+)isomenthone were detected in many oils of Mentha, Micromeria fruticosa (L.) Druce and Calamintha i n d n a (Sm.)

Heldr. High enantiomeric purities of (+)-menthone and (-)-isomenthone were detected in commercial and freshly distilled geranium oils.
